Maddie focuses on representing lenders who originate and sell loans secured by multifamily real estate projects to secondary market investors,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ac. Within this practice, Maddie conducts title examinations, survey examinations and other due diligence, reviews legal opinions, and prepares loan documents.

Multifamily Finance

Moss & Barnett has become one of the leading law firms nationwide in representing Freddie Mac and Fannie Mae lenders. The firm has closed thousands of these loans in every product line, including:

  • Portfolio and capital markets executions
  • Credit facilities and other structured transactions
  • Tax-exempt bond and other targeted affordable housing programs
  • Seniors housing
  • Manufactured housing
  • Small-balance loans
